Best logging practices?

Issue:
Enter a description of your issue here, in full detail.

Initially, I’m using debug level but it was polluted by lot of stuff that I’m not interested in.
If I’m using highest log level then it’s a waste of time to manual find and replace if I’m done with it.

System Information

  • Operating System:
  • CPU:
  • GPU:
  • Citra Version (found in title bar):
  • Game:
  • Screenshot of Issue (include the full Citra window including titlebar):

Diagnostic Log
Upload your log file as an attachment by dragging & dropping.

In order to save a copy of the log, follow this guide:
https://community.citra-emu.org/t/how-to-upload-the-log-file/296

In order for us to provide better support, we need to see the log generated by Citra. This guide will walk you through how you can obtain the log file: How to Upload the Log File.

If you want you can do this *:Debug HW.GPU:Critical Service.DSP:Critical Audio.DSP:Critical Service.GSP:Critical Render.OpenGL:Critical Service.HID:Critical

I ran this a few years ago while debugging UDS(networking). You can check the log if you want to add more to show only as Critical.

1 Like